Errors in the Scanned Result

If an error is displayed in the Scanned Result column after you scan the color chart for colorimetry, check the error code, and operate as required.

Error Code Issue Solution and reference
02XX0002

04XX0003

04XX0009

04XX000A

(XX represents a hexadecimal number between 00–ff)

A system error occurred. Restart Windows.
02XX0004

(XX represents a hexadecimal number between 00–ff)

An unexpected problem occurred. Contact your service representative. Collect the device log as required.
02010007 The destination folder is deleted. In the Colorimetry Measurements dialog, select the correct folder in the File Location field.
02020008 A file with the same name exists in the destination folder.
  • Move or delete the corresponding file from the folder selected in the File Location field displayed in the Colorimetry Measurements dialog.
  • Enter the correct file name in the File Name field displayed in the Colorimetry Measurements dialog.
0402000C A scanner error occurred. Check the message and operate as required.

Fix the error. Then, restart the scanner and your operating system.

0403000C Failed to scan the chart. Scan the chart again. If the error persists, reprint the chart in the center of the paper, and then scan the reprinted chart.
00010006 The measurement result file is not output after you scan a custom chart.

This problem occurs because the ID of the scanned chart does not match the ID of the chart you select for scanning in the Colorimetry dialog.

Scan a chart whose chart ID matches the ID of the chart you select for scanning in the Colorimetry dialog.
020F0007 After you select the destination folder for saving the measurement file, the File Location field is blank again. Select the destination folder again. If the error persists, contact your service representative.
0403000D The scanned chart does not match the chart you select for scanning in the Colorimetry dialog. In the Colorimetry dialog, select a chart that matches the chart placed in the paper tray.
Colorimetry Timeout Error A paper jam or another problem occurred when scanning an original. Solve the problem on the scanner.

If the error persists, contact your service representative.
